How It Works: A Simple, Powerful Flow

Our platform is designed to be as straightforward as possible for business teams, while delivering the depth of features required by enterprise-scale applications. Here is the typical flow used by clients in sectors such as auto shipping logistics and on-demand task marketplaces like remotasks:

  1. API integration: Your system makes a request to our API to initiate a verification for a given session. You provide a minimal payload—usually a session identifier, the destination country, and the verification type.
  2. Temporary, privacy-preserving numbers: The platform assigns a temporary number from the pool, selected to maximize deliverability while minimizing exposure of personal data to downstream systems.
  3. SMS delivery: The verification code is delivered through the chosen number. The message is routed via direct carrier connections or trusted aggregators to ensure speed and reliability.
  4. Code capture and validation: Your backend captures the verification code from the incoming SMS and validates it against your internal flow. Our webhooks provide near real-time status updates.
  5. Session completion and data governance: After verification, the session data is handled according to your retention policy. Personal data is not retained beyond what is legally required, reinforcing privacy.

Technical Details of Operation

Understanding the architecture helps CTOs and IT leaders assess risk and ensure compatibility with enterprise requirements. Here are the core technical components and how they work together to deliver dependable SMS verification at scale:

  • Messaging backbone: We maintain direct routes with Tier-1 operators alongside carefully vetted aggregators. This hybrid approach balances speed, coverage, and cost while reducing the likelihood of carrier blocks.
  • Number provisioning and rotation: A large, geographically distributed pool of numbers is used. Numbers are rotated per session to minimize blacklisting risks and to improve deliverability in regional markets.
  • API security: All API calls are secured with TLS 1.2+ and API keys. Client IPs can be restricted via allowlists, and role-based access controls restrict sensitive actions to authorized teams.
  • Webhooks and event streams: Real-time notifications (delivery, read, expiration, or bounce events) are pushed to your servers via Webhooks, enabling immediate action in your verification workflow.
  • Latency and performance: The system is tuned for low-latency messaging. Typical end-to-end latency ranges from a few hundred milliseconds to under a second under normal conditions.
  • Redundancy and disaster recovery: The platform runs across multiple data centers with automatic failover, snapshot-based backups, and tested recovery procedures to keep verification available even during outages.
  • Data privacy controls: We minimize data captured for verification. Logs retain only operational metadata essential for debugging and security audits, complying with your data governance policy.
  • Analytics and reporting: Dashboards and reports provide visibility into delivery rates, rejection reasons, regional performance, and verification success trends, helping you optimize onboarding.
